|
|
|
|
@ -16,7 +16,6 @@ class EquipmentBase(DefaultBase):
|
|
|
|
|
forecasting_start_year: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
forecasting_target_year: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
manhours_rate: Optional[float] = Field(None, nullable=True)
|
|
|
|
|
min_eac_info: Optional[str] = Field(None, nullable=True)
|
|
|
|
|
harga_saat_ini: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
minimum_eac_seq: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
minimum_eac_year: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
@ -120,7 +119,6 @@ class EquipmentTop10(EquipmentBase):
|
|
|
|
|
minimum_pmt: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
minimum_pmt_aq_cost: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
minimum_is_actual: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
# min_eac_info: Optional[str] = Field(None, nullable=True)
|
|
|
|
|
harga_saat_ini: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
remaining_life: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
|
|
|
|
|
@ -138,7 +136,6 @@ class EquipmentDataMaster(EquipmentBase):
|
|
|
|
|
minimum_pmt: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
minimum_pmt_aq_cost: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
minimum_is_actual: Optional[int] = Field(None, nullable=True)
|
|
|
|
|
# min_eac_info: Optional[str] = Field(None, nullable=True)
|
|
|
|
|
harga_saat_ini: Optional[float] = Field(None, nullable=True, le=MAX_PRICE)
|
|
|
|
|
|
|
|
|
|
# class EquipmentTop10EconomicLife(DefaultBase):
|
|
|
|
|
|